Tul Yek (Persian: طول یک, also Romanized as Ţūl Yeḵ; also known as Tūlī)[1] is a village in Mazu Rural District, Alvar-e Garmsiri District, Andimeshk County, Khuzestan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its existence was noted, but its population was not reported.[2]
